PEOPLE v. PAPPA


43 A.D.2d 836 (1974)

The People of the State of New York, Appellant, v. Gerard Pappa, Respondent

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, Second Department.

January 4, 1974


Appeal dismissed.

The People's notice of appeal was filed on August 17, 1971, some 15 days prior to the effective date of the Criminal Procedure Law on September 1, 1971. Under the former Code of Criminal Procedure, no appeal lay from an order such as the one at bar.
